Output b1c8286eccbdfbc4731bb292c83ba0fa1438296a70a9e2f879c991bfd6882b77:40

value
2444555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37aee67f68c1c3f91705b42f4e4dbe1d3f4fad98 OP_EQUAL
address
36mScPLhzV4NMoVD1TuoLuFyQrSncjAh9y
transaction
b1c8286eccbdfbc4731bb292c83ba0fa1438296a70a9e2f879c991bfd6882b77
confirmations
163855
spent
true